[ Поиск ] - [ Пользователи ] - [ Календарь ]
Полная Версия: Управлять формой на сайте
slavuta
У меня есть проблема.
Есть форма http://www2.thebigchallenge.com/de/formulaire_v2_of.php
Мне нужно получить из неё все значения из полей:
-Bundesland
-Ort
-Schule
-Anschrift
-E-mail der Schule

Для всех изменяемых значений из полей:
-Bundesland
-Ort
-Schule
С post запросом через адресную строку у меня не получилось.
У кого есть какие мысли. Спасибо
sergeiss
Цитата (slavuta @ 2.03.2016 - 15:12)
С post запросом через адресную строку у меня не получилось.

Ты определись: постом или через адресную строку (это уже get потому что). И что значит не "получилось"? Что именн ты делал?

У тебя в форме прописан метод post, на принимающей стороне анализируй массив $_POST.

_____________
* Хэлп по PHP
* Описалово по JavaScript
* Хэлп и СУБД для PostgreSQL

* Обучаю PHP, JS, вёрстке. Интерактивно и качественно. За разумные деньги.

* "накапливаю умение телепатии" (С) и "гуглю за ваш счет" (С)

user posted image
slavuta
Я ввёл ссылку http://www2.thebigchallenge.com/de/formula...valid=selection
которую создал отследив передачу данных через Live HTTP Headers в Mozilla и форма не обновилась, а мне нужно чтобы произошло заполнение полей и selectov. По большому счёту не имеет значения каким образом это сделать, но мне нужно программно произвести select по полям:
в начале "Bundesland" затем "Ort" и потом "Schule".
slavuta
Спасибо, решение найдено.
Kusss
проще всего через serialize.
<form method="post" id="myform">
тут поля формы
</form>
<div
id="result"></div>
var value = $('#myform').serialize();
$.post('form.php', { 'value' : value})
.
done ( function(date){
$('#result').html(date);
});
if (isset($_POST['value'])) {
parse_str($_POST['value'], $array);
print_r($array);
}

add Если нужно все значения получить без запроса на сервер (в js), то вот http://phpjs.org/functions/parse_str/
Быстрый ответ:

 Графические смайлики |  Показывать подпись
Здесь расположена полная версия этой страницы.
Invision Power Board © 2001-2024 Invision Power Services, Inc.